Japan First-class Sofa Market Size Analysis: Addressable Demand and Growth Potential

The Japan first-class sofa market represents a premium segment within the broader furniture industry, characterized by high-quality craftsmanship, luxury materials, and innovative design features. As of 2023, the total market size is estimated at approximately JPY 150 billion (USD 1.4 billion), reflecting robust demand driven by rising disposable incomes, urban affluence, and evolving consumer preferences for luxury home furnishings.

Market Size, TAM, SAM, SOM Analysis

  • Total Addressable Market (TAM): Encompasses all potential demand for first-class sofas across Japan, including both domestic consumption and export opportunities. Based on household penetration rates, luxury real estate development, and premium hospitality sectors, TAM is estimated at JPY 150 billion.
  • Serviceable Available Market (SAM): Focuses on the segment accessible to premium sofa manufacturers and brands operating within Japan, excluding niche or highly specialized markets. Considering the premium segment’s share within the overall furniture market (~15%), SAM is approximately JPY 22.5 billion.
  • Serviceable Obtainable Market (SOM): Represents the realistic market share achievable by key players over the next 3-5 years, factoring in brand strength, distribution channels, and consumer loyalty. With strategic positioning, SOM is projected at JPY 4.5 billion.

Growth Drivers and Penetration Scenarios

  • Increasing urban affluence and lifestyle upgrades are expected to sustain a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of approximately 4-6% over the next five years.
  • Growing demand from high-end residential projects, luxury hotels, and corporate offices enhances market expansion prospects.
  • Adoption rates for first-class sofas are projected to reach 10-12% penetration within the premium furniture segment by 2028, driven by consumer desire for exclusivity and comfort.

Segment-wise Opportunities

  • Regional: Tokyo metropolitan area accounts for over 50% of luxury furniture sales, with secondary growth in Osaka and Nagoya.
  • Application: Residential luxury apartments, high-end hotels, corporate executive suites, and exclusive lounges.
  • Customer Type: Ultra-high-net-worth individuals (UHNWIs), luxury property developers, boutique hotel chains, and interior design firms.

Operational Challenges and Regulatory Landscape

  • High manufacturing costs and supply chain complexities, especially for bespoke components.
  • Stringent safety standards, fire-retardant regulations, and eco-certifications (e.g., FSC, GREENGUARD) require compliance timelines.
  • Import tariffs and trade policies impacting raw material sourcing and distribution channels.
